在当今这个信息爆炸的时代,搜索引擎已经成为我们获取知识的重要工具,而在众多的搜索引擎中,百度以其强大的搜索能力和丰富的资源吸引了大量的用户,传统的百度搜索界面虽然功能强大,但用户体验并不理想,我们希望通过学习并实践jQuery,为百度搜索添加一些新的功能,使其更加符合现代用户的使用习惯。
我们需要理解百度搜索的基本结构和功能,百度的搜索页面主要由以下几个部分组成:搜索框、搜索按钮、热门搜索词、新闻、图片、视频等模块,这些部分都需要我们进行操作和修改,以实现我们的搜索效果。
接下来,我们将开始编写代码,我们需要引入jQuery库,jQuery是一个流行的JavaScript库,它简化了JavaScript编程,使开发者能够更容易地处理HTML文档、事件、动画等。
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
我们需要创建一个搜索框和一个搜索按钮,这两个元素将作为用户输入搜索内容和提交搜索请求的关键。
<input type="text" id="search-box" placeholder="请输入搜索内容"> <button id="search-btn">搜索</button>
接下来,我们需要编写一段jQuery代码,当用户点击搜索按钮时,获取用户输入的搜索内容,并将其作为搜索参数发送给百度服务器。
$('#search-btn').click(function() { var searchContent = $('#search-box').val(); window.location.href = 'https://www.baidu.com/s?wd=' + encodeURIComponent(searchContent); });
这段代码首先获取了用户输入的搜索内容,然后将其作为搜索参数添加到百度的搜索URL中,最后通过window.location.href
将浏览器的当前页面跳转到新的搜索结果页面。
以上就是我们使用jQuery实现百度搜索效果的基本步骤,通过学习和实践,我们可以更好地理解和jQuery的使用,从而为我们的网页添加更多的功能和交互性。
还没有评论,来说两句吧...